Manager, Targeting and Business Analytics (3024114 KD)
SUMMARY OF K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
To analyze, design and support trimesterly call planning strategy in coordination with the AD Resource Allocation and Director SFE. To provide help in designing alignments based on call plan objectives for the Sales force. To manage all data inputs and the call planning application in partnership with our call planning vendor. To leverage all data and information and support systems to insure maximum value is attained from all Sales Operations information sources in the call planning process and management reporting. To support other priority projects in the Sales Operations department as the need exists.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S REQUIRED FOR JOB
Work with the Associate Director, Resource Allocation to manage and maintain call planning processes.
Provide in depth analysis to the project team designing and implementing all Sepracor field force structures.
Act as the key support person for managing business rules, data inputs and answering questions regarding the call planning application.
Work with Resource Allocation analyst to support additional processes such as address updates, scrubbing and zip code adjustments.
Run reports for all call planning presentations and ad hoc requests for internal management to insure reporting and analytical needs are met.
Support the implementation of field sales force alignments.
Work with Sepracor's field management, Marketing, Organized Customer Group, Medical Liaison, Finance and Information Technologies groups to provide support and technical solutions to enhance Sales analysis and targeting.
Develop general knowledge of other major projects within Sales Operations including Incentive Compensation plan reporting and automation, Regional business analysis, Microstrategy reporting and ad hoc requests as required.
Support the AD, Resource Allocation to implement a new Call Planning software rollout that helps streamline our targeting processes.
Work with the Associate Director, Resource Allocation to proactively identify opportunities that give our company a competitive advantage.
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ED
Education
Bachelor's Degree is required.
Master's level education is a plus.
3-5 years of Sales Analysis, and Resource allocation experience preferably in the pharmaceutical industry.
Experience
Extensive knowledge of Excel and SAS. Experience with Access and Powerpoint.
Territory alignment coordination and design is necessary.
Knowledge of Alignment Reporting systems and Microstrategy Decision Support System is a plus.
Experience with other Sales reporting such as contact management, sample accountability, contracting, sales force automation, and comprehensive business reporting.
Excellent interpersonal, analytical, organizational, team building, verbal, and written skills.
